What is Mother of Pearl?
Before diving into the beauty of nativity scenes crafted from this material, let's understand what Mother of Pearl actually is. Mother of pearl, also known as nacre, is the iridescent inner layer of certain mollusk shells, most notably oysters and abalone. Its shimmering, opalescent quality is due to the complex layering of aragonite crystals, creating an ethereal, captivating glow. This natural material is prized for its beauty and has been used for centuries in jewelry, ornamentation, and decorative arts.

What are Mother of Pearl Nativity Sets Made Of?
Mother of Pearl nativity sets are primarily crafted from, as the name suggests, mother of pearl. The figures are meticulously carved and shaped from the iridescent shell, often showcasing intricate details in the clothing, faces, and postures of the figures. Some sets might incorporate other materials, such as wood or resin, for the base or supporting structures, but the focal point remains the stunning Mother of Pearl figures.
How to Care for Your Mother of Pearl Nativity Set?
To ensure your Mother of Pearl nativity set remains beautiful for years to come, proper care is essential:
-
Gentle Handling: Avoid dropping or bumping the figures, as they can be fragile.
-
Dusting: Regularly dust your nativity set with a soft cloth or brush.
-
Polishing: Occasional polishing with a specialized jewelry polishing cloth can help maintain the luster of the Mother of Pearl.
-
Storage: Store your nativity set in a cool, dry place away from direct sunlight and extreme temperatures to prevent discoloration or damage.

Are Mother of Pearl Nativity Sets Expensive?
The price of a Mother of Pearl nativity set can vary greatly depending on the size, intricacy of detail, the number of figures included, and the craftsmanship involved. While some smaller sets might be relatively affordable, larger, more elaborate sets with intricate detailing can be quite expensive, reflecting the artistry and materials used.
How Do I Clean a Mother of Pearl Nativity Set?
Cleaning your Mother of Pearl nativity set should be done gently. Use a soft, dry cloth or a very slightly damp cloth (avoid soaking!) to wipe away dust and grime. Avoid harsh chemicals or abrasive cleaners. For stubborn stains, consult a professional jewelry cleaner or conservator.
